LondonElite, While YYZ-DEL nonstop route may take time to develop it has a strong market potential. DEL flt is convenient for immigrants from the Punjab area of India and there are quite a few in Canada (a good section accessible through YYZ). The problem is tha a good part of this market is price sensitive and the yields will be quite low.
There are quite a few others interested in YYZ-BLR, YYZ-MAA, YYZ-BOM, YYZ-HYD, etc. Given this group, a non-stop YYZ-DEL enables domestic connection in India much better. DEL and BOM are already hub cities in India for all major domestic carriers so the final destination becomes a one-stop flt.
In short, I think because of the non-stop connection from North Amercia YYZ-DEL can become quite attractive. I am not sure if it will drastically cut into AC's YYZ-LHR route but it will impact the North America-India travel corridor and this will have a minor impact on YYZ-LHR.
